After rain, find the best puddle and investigate it systematically: estimate depth with a stick, draw the outline with chalk, test what floats vs. sinks. Mark the puddle edge and return in 30 minutes to see how much it shrank. The puddle becomes a lab.
What you need
- chalk (optional)
- stick
How to do it
- 1Find the best puddle. Measure depth with a stick. Make an estimate before you look.
- 2Drop a leaf, a twig, a stone, a bit of bark. Floats or sinks?
- 3Mark the puddle's edge with chalk.
- 4Return in 30 minutes. How much of the chalk line is now on dry pavement?

💡 Parent tip
On hot sunny days the shrinkage visible in 20 minutes is dramatic enough that even 3-year-olds are genuinely surprised.
What your child develops
- Scientific method — forming a prediction and checking it
- Cause and effect — understanding evaporation as a visible process
- Density intuition — why some things float and others sink
Safety notes
- Boots recommended. Keep children away from deep or fast-moving water.
